MACLAINE ADDED COCAINE TO COFFEE, MISTAKING IT FOR SUGAR
Oscar winner SHIRLEY MACLAINE once outraged a party hostess by mistaking cocaine for sugar - and putting white powder worth $1,000 (GBP500) in her cup of coffee. The Terms Of Endearment star insists she has led a drug-free existence, with the exception of smoking marijuana one time and eating some cannabis-laced "bang brownies" late actor Robert Mitchum gave her on another occasion. So MACLaine, 73, had no idea she was adding a small fortune in cocaine to her coffee at the posh event. In her new memoir Sage-ing While Age-ing, she recalls, "At a fancy dinner party in Hollywood, I put a teaspoon of what I thought was very refined sugar in my demitasse coffee. "The hostess was horrified because is was $1,000 dollars' worth of coke. I didn't drink the coffee and I was never invited back." MACLaine tells WENN, "I thought it was Sweet n' Low... That's not something that restaurants serve.
